Course Description
This course is part 1 of 2 of the Cisco CCIE Routing and Switching: Implementing Layer 2 Technologies series. This course is part of a series of courses to prepare candidates to pass the CCIE Routing and Switching written exam, as well as to provide CCIE candidates with a strong level of fundamental knowledge needed to begin studying for the CCIE Routing and Switching lab exam. In this course, your instructor, Joe Astorino, will cover all of the topics listed under the "Implement Layer 2 Technologies" of the current CCIE Routing and Switching written exam blueprint including Spanning-Tree Protocol, Frame-Relay, Ethernet technologies, and more. The course is designed for those who have at least a CCNP R&S level of knowledge.
